Hey everyone, Zack Snyder is back with the second part of his 'Rebel Moon Epic' - The Scargiver. This film is intended to close out the story set up in Part One and, apparently, set up four other sequels or something (WHY???). As someone who enjoyed Part One enough and thought there was potential for this universe, Part Two quickly drained all the hope I had for this 'franchise'. Find out why in this SPOILER-FREE review! Rebel Moon - Part Two: The Scargiver: Directed by: Zack Snyder Screenplay by: Shay Hatten, Kurt Johnstad, Zack Snyder Story by: Zack Snyder Produced by: Eric Newman, Zack Snyder, Deborah Snyder Executive Producers: Sarah Bowen, Shay Hatten, Kurt Johnstad, Bergen Swanson Music by: Tom Holkenborg Cinematography by: Zack Snyder Edited by: Dody Dorn Casting by: Kristy Carlson Production Design by: Stefan Dechant, Stephen Swain Set Decoration by: Claudia Bonfe Costume Design by: Stephanie Portnoy Porter Cast: Sofia Boutella, Michiel Huisman, Ed Skrein, Djimon Hounsou, Bae Doona, Staz Nair, E. Duffy, Anthony Hopkins Synopsis: The rebels gear up for battle against the Motherworld as unbreakable bonds are forged, heroes emerge — and legends are made.
